Paradigms of the state

The Mykonos archaeologist – who gets paid about the same amount of money as the businesses he was tasked to inspect spend on champagne – was just doing his job. 

He is one of thousands of examples of civil service employees who have not been swallowed up by the “deep state.” These are the people that the proper state needs to acknowledge and reward accordingly for their efforts. They need to be held up as paradigms for everyone else.
